December 12, 2015

A fire in the early hours of Saturday morning has destroyed the historic Kandanga Hotel.

The occupants of the building escaped unharmed.

Firefighters could not save the 101-year-old wooden pub but prevented the flames from reaching nearby properties.

Owners Doug and Carolyn Greensill and their son John took over the business in May this year.

They formerly ran the Grand Hotel in Wooroolin.

The family escaped the blaze, which started about 5:00am, after being alerted by neighbours.
